Numerical simulations in astronomy refer to computer-based models used to simulate and analyze astronomical phenomena and processes.
Key Features
- Accurate representation of complex astronomical scenarios
- Prediction of celestial events and behaviors
- Exploration of theoretical concepts in astrophysics
- Visualization tools for better understanding
Pros
- Provides insights into inaccessible or rare astronomical events
- Helps test and refine theories in astrophysics
- Allows for the study of extreme environments like black holes and supernovae
Cons
- Limited by computational power and resources
- Assumption-based models may not always accurately reflect reality
